About Second Helpings
At Second Helpings we envision a community where everyone has enough nourishing food and ample opportunities to thrive. Our mission is to address hunger today and build self-sufficiency to prevent hunger tomorrow.
Founded in 1998 by three chefs Second Helpings remains true to its core mission while the ability to serve our community has continued to 2025 we rescued 4.9 million pounds of food and distributed over 2.3 million meals through our 200 area partners.

Job Summary:
The Dish Room Steward supports the Hunger Relief Department by overseeing dish room activities including training others and maintaining cleanliness and sanitation in the building.

Physical Demands and Work Environment: Regularly required to stand walk use hands reach talk hear and smell. Must be able to lift/move up to 50 pounds and maintain a brisk pace. Frequently exposed to wet/humid conditions and extreme heat; occasionally exposed to fumes airborne particles mechanical parts and electric shock risks. Noise levels range from moderate to loud.
